Bill & Sarah Altland are 1980 graduates of the University of Arkansas Medical School College of Pharmacy.  From there they served as volunteer medical missionaries in Zaire (now the Democratic Republic of Congo), Haiti, and at a missions clinic in Glennallen, Alaska.  In 1999, they moved to Prince of Wales Island and shared the pharmacist job at Alicia Roberts Medical Center in Klawock.  In addition, Bill has periodically traveled to fill in for pharmacists in other locations, such as Dillingham, Valdez, Wasilla, Cordova, Bethel, Kodiak, Wrangell, Metlakatla, Ketchikan and Sitka in Alaska, and in South Dakota.

When they came to POW, the Altlands saw the need for a retail pharmacy and decided Craig is the place where they want to raise their family and be a part of the community.  So in April 2001, they opened Whale Tail Pharmacy, located at 300-B Easy Street.
